Abstract

Epiphytes are types of plants that attach and grow on other plants to obtain sunlight, water, air, and minerals for their growth. The aim of this study are knowing the diversity of vascular  epiphytes on the host trunks of Angiosperms and Gymnosperms, knowing the differences in vascular epiphytic communities on the host trunks of Angiosperms and Gymnosperms and to determine factors causing vascular epiphytes communities on the host trunk is used in this research. Sampling plot is located on the host tree's trunk to facilitate the calculation of vascular epiphytes; a simple plot measuring 2 m x 0,5 m was made facing east and west. Determination of the number of tree sampling is done based on the Area Species Curve. The results of this study indicate that the vascular epiphyte diversity on trunks of Gymnospermae is higher than Angiospermae, meanwhile that Shannon Wiener diversity index of vascular epiphytes on Angiosperms and Gymnosperms host trunks being moderate category. Jaccard Similarity index  was 0.44 and indicated the different of epiphytes community between  Angiospermae and Gymnospermae tree host. The dominant species based on Important value index in Angiosperms are Davallia hymenophylloides (35,05%), Goniophlebium subauriculatum (20,92%), and Dendrobium mutabile (20,07) while ini Gymnosperme are Davallia hymenophylloides (41,36%), Goniophlebium subauriculatum (15,94%), and Peperomia tetraphylla (15,55%). In Angiospermae, the factors that influence the diversity of vascular epiphyte species are roughness and thickness, while in Gymnosperms the influential factors are roughness and diameter.

Abstract

Macroalgae have various types of polysaccharides such as alginate, gelatin, and bioactive compounds and contain potential pigments as drugs. Research on the diversity of macroalgae types that are potentially as medicinal substances in the waters of Cidatu Beach Pandeglang has done. Research is done by transek method. Sampling locations are differentiated into three stations. Each station is made of three transect with a distance between 5 m and each transect consisting of five plots 1x1 m with a distance between plots 5 m. The potentially medicinal macroalgae in the waters of Cidatu are 10 species which are 3 species of the Chlorophyceae class (Ulva intestinalis, Ulva reticulata and Chaetomorpha crassa), 4 species of the class Phaeophyceae (Padina australis, Turbinaria decurrens, Sargassum crassifolium, and Sargassum polycystum) and 3 species of the class Rhodophyceae (Gracilaria salicornia, Gracilaria coronopifolia and Gelidium sp). The index of diversity in Cidatu beach is 2.169 which is categorized diversity moderate type.
